Toolse is yet another beer from the Viru Brewery in Estonia, available in 0.5 litre glass bottles, you'd be forgiven for thinking that this was an Irish or Scottish beer as it proudly shows off a ruined castle on the green label. Whilst I can't really agree with the breweries thoughts on ancient fortresses representing a refreshing easy to drink beer, I can agree with the last part- Toolse is maybe a little bit too easy to drink if anything, it's 4.7% which is weakish but no crime, however the taste would suggest otherwise as it's a very watery beer.
